Commissioning test using bit-wise readout
Test steps
1
Run the application (all the servo drives
are enabled).
2
Stop the application.
3
Disable all the servo drives.
4
Enable STO.
5
Disable STO.
6
Run the application (all the servo drives
are enabled).
7
Enable STO.
8
Try to run the application (enable 1 or
more servo drives).
9
Disable STO.
10
Try to run the application (enable 1 or
more servo drives).
11
Send a reset signal via the PLC.
12
Try to run the application (all servo drives
are enabled).
Table 2.7 Commissioning Test using Bit-Wise Readout

Reason for the test step
Check that the application can run.
Check that STO can be activated without
error.
Check that STO can be deactivated
without error. No reset is required.
Check that errors are generated correctly
when STO is activated while the servo
drives are running.
Checks that the STO function is working
correctly.
Check that the STO start is still inhibited
by the error signal.
Check whether reset is required.

Expected result
Application runs as expected.
All servo drives are at speed 0 RPM.
All servo drives are disabled.
Statusword bit 3 = 0 and bit 14 =1 in all
servo drives.
Statusword bit 3 = 0 and bit 14 =0 in all
servo drives.
Application runs as expected.
Motors are torque free. Motors coast and
stop after some time.
Statusword bit 3 = 1, bit 14 = 1 and
object 0x603F shows fault 0xFF80 in all
servo drives.
Application does not run.
Statusword bit 3 = 1, bit 14 = 0 and
object 0x603F shows fault 0xFF80 in all
servo drives.
Application does not run.
Statusword bit 3 = 0 in all servo drives.
Application runs as expected.
